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
820022 892087 230 4808391
586160 4145668
586160 4145668
7547639555 9026528530 323
All about undefined
Interested in learning more?
586160 4145668
7547639555 9026528530 323
See more
7908667 3895646529
06294 4174 37387112986
See more
72157135620 33816648
6725416 05018545 458516226 948
See more